Here's a boy in an ulu boarding school trying to give himself some medicine. Any mother's heart would break seeing this picture. He does not have a cup. He uses his multipurpose basin for his water.

These children wash their own clothes. (This is the way they wash their clothes - they put the clothes under a tap. Wash! Wash! And then hang the clothes to dry. After their first week in school the school mother will show them how to wash...but they don't have money to buy soap powder/detergent. And the school does not supply them that...so the primary school children wear very OFF White shirts full of molds.....)

Ensurai said...

Yes the Ulu Children of Sarawak Indigenous Peoples start boarding school at the age of 6 when they enter Primary one. Hopefully Kemas and other Kindergartens would start their classes in the various longhouses...so that no kids are left behind.....Question : how does a child of 6 or 7 learn to keep himself clean?

May I tell you something funny and sad at the same time. When my Dad was working as DEO and school supervisor, he visited such school. He saw kids eating out of leaves.

He asked didn't the school buy plates.

Yes, said the principal, but they kids were lazy to wash so they threw the away in the bush and the stream and report they had lost them. With leaves, there was no need to wash.
